    Abstract: An electro-luminescent film including a substrate and anisotropic semiconductor nanoparticles distributed on the substrate according to a periodic pattern. The semiconductor nanoparticles have an aspect ratio greater than 1.5, and the repetition unit of the pattern has a smallest dimension of less than 500 micrometer and includes at least one pixel. Also, a process for the manufacture of the electro-luminescent film, and a light emitting device that includes the electro-luminescent film.

    Abstract: A light sensitive device including a substrate and high pass filter semiconductor nanoparticles distributed on the substrate. The substrate includes at least one photosensor, and the semiconductor nanoparticles are high pass filters in UV-visible-NIR light range. The light sensitive device has a density of the semiconductor nanoparticles per surface unit of greater than 5×109 nanoparticles.cm?2. Also, a process for the manufacture of the light sensitive device, and an image sensor that includes the light sensitive device.

A method of changing user credentials by creating a queue of credentials for facilitating access to at least one account of a user, where each credential in the queue of credentials is randomly and automatically generated using information provided by the user without additional input from the user; detecting a deactivation event relating to an account of the at least one account of the user; responsive to the detected deactivation event, deactivating a current credential for the account; and activating a new credential to facilitate access to the account, where the new credential is next in the queue of credentials.

    Abstract: Solutions are provided for auto-labeling sensor data for machine learning (ML). An example includes: determining a platform's own position; recording, from a sensor aboard the platform, sensor data comprising a sensor image; receiving position data for at least one intruder object (e.g., a nearby airborne object); based at least on the position data for the intruder object and the platform's position, determining a relative position and a relative velocity of the intruder object; based at least on the relative position and a relative velocity of the intruder object and a field of view of the sensor, determining an expected position of the intruder object in the sensor image; labeling the sensor image, wherein the labeling comprises annotating the sensor image with a region of interest and an object identification; and training an artificial intelligence (AI) model using the labeled sensor image.

    Abstract: This technology enables prioritization of Multiple Stream Reservation Protocol (“MSRP”) transmissions in Audio Video Bridging (“AVB”) virtual local area networks (“VLANs”). An AVB switch receives a status from listener devices, associates a state with each of the statuses indicating whether each listener device is active or in-active, and stores each state in a database. For each listener device, a queue of MSRP protocol data unit (“PDU”) packets exists to be transmitted to the listener device. The AVB switch searches the database for listener devices with an active state, searches the queue for each active listener device for packets associated with an active state, and transmits the packets associated with the active state to each active listener device. Subsequently, the AVB switch searches each listener device's queue for packets associated with an in-active state and transmits the packets associated with an in-active state to each listener device.

    Abstract: The subject technology may be implemented by a device that includes at least one processor configured to encrypt a data object based at least in part on an encryption key. The at least one processor may be further configured to sign the encrypted data object with a private key and transmit the signed encrypted data object to a server for retrieval by another device. The at least one processor may be further configured to generate a sharing object corresponding to the data object, wherein the sharing object includes an encryption key and a public key that corresponds to the private key. The at least one processor may be further configured to encrypt the sharing object using a key of the other device and transmit, over a secure channel, the encrypted sharing object to the other device for subsequent retrieval and verification of the signed data object from the server.
